5 Disconnecting the Inverter from Voltage Sources
Prior to performing any work on the inverter, always disconnect it from all voltage sources as
described in this section. Always adhere to the prescribed sequence.
DANGER
Danger to life due to electric shock when live components or DC conductors
are touched
When exposed to sunlight, the PV array generates dangerous direct voltage. Even if the DC
load-break switch of the inverter is in the O, position, there will be dangerous direct voltage
present in the DC conductors and on the DC-in terminal block in the Connection Unit. Touching
live DC conductors results in death or lethal injuries due to electric shock.
If an external DC disconnecting switch is available, open the external DC disconnecting
switch.
Leave the DC-in terminal block plugged into the Connection Unit and only touch it on the
black enclosure.
NOTICE
Destruction of the measuring device due to overvoltage
Only use measuring devices with a DC input voltage range of 600V or higher.
Procedure:
1. Disconnect the AC circuit breaker and secure it against reconnection.
2. Set the DC load-break switch of the inverter to O.
3. If the multifunction relay is used, switch off any supply voltage to the load.
4. Wait until the LEDs have gone out.
5. Unscrew all six screws of the enclosure lid of the Connection Unit and remove the enclosure lid
carefully towards the front (TX25). When doing so, note that the LED assembly in the
enclosure lid and the communication assembly in the inverter are connected via a ribbon
cable.
